Introduction to Microwaves
The microwave oven was first introduced in the late 1940s by Percy Spencer, an American engineer and inventor. The first microwave oven stood over 5 feet tall and weighed over 750 pounds, a far cry from the compact, user-friendly appliances we see today. Initially, microwaves were met with skepticism, but they quickly gained popularity for their ability to cook and reheat food rapidly. The name “microwave” comes from the fact that these ovens use microwaves, a form of electromagnetic radiation, to heat and cook food.
How Microwaves Work
Microwaves work by penetrating the food with microwave radiation, which causes the water molecules in the food to rotate back and forth at the same frequency as the microwaves. This movement generates heat through dielectric heating, effectively cooking the food. The turntable in a microwave oven helps to distribute the microwaves evenly, ensuring that the food is cooked uniformly. This process is not only fast but also energy-efficient, as microwaves directly heat the food, not the surrounding air or the cooking vessel.

Nutritional Value and Safety
Studies have indicated that microwaving can preserve the nutrients in food better than some other cooking methods. For example, microwaving can help retain the vitamin C content in vegetables more effectively than boiling. As for safety, the consensus among health and safety organizations, including the World Health Organization (WHO), is that microwave ovens are safe when used according to the manufacturer’s instructions.

What are the safety concerns associated with microwave usage?
Microwave safety has been a topic of concern for many years, with some worrying about the potential health risks of exposure to microwave radiation. The main safety concerns associated with microwaves include the risk of radiation exposure, the danger of superheating liquids, and the potential for fires or explosions. However, it is essential to note that modern microwaves are designed with safety features to minimize these risks, such as interlocks that prevent the oven from operating when the door is open and sensors that detect abnormal cooking conditions.
To ensure safe microwave usage, it is crucial to follow the manufacturer’s instructions and guidelines for cooking times, power levels, and container usage. Additionally, consumers should be aware of the risks of overheating or igniting certain materials, such as metal, foil, or paper products. Regular maintenance, such as cleaning the oven and checking for worn or damaged components, can also help prevent accidents. Can microwaves be used for cooking frozen foods safely?
Microwaves are a popular choice for cooking frozen foods, including leftovers, meals, and vegetables. However, there are concerns about the safety of cooking frozen foods in the microwave, particularly regarding the risk of undercooking or overcooking. To cook frozen foods safely, it is essential to follow the recommended cooking instructions and guidelines provided by the manufacturer. This may involve defrosting the food first, using the defrost function, or cooking the food in short intervals with stirring or checking in between.
When cooking frozen foods in the microwave, it is crucial to ensure that the food reaches a safe internal temperature to prevent foodborne illness. This can be achieved by using a food thermometer to check the internal temperature of the food or by following the recommended cooking time and power level.
